    Digital disruptors are new technologies or business models that have the potential to transform the way an industry operates. They often arise from the convergence of multiple technologies. Such technologies include the Internet, mobile devices, artificial intelligence, and big data analytics. These disruptors can create significant challenges for established businesses but offer exciting opportunities for innovation and growth.

    In recent years, digital disruptors have become synonymous with start-ups and up-and-coming companies leveraging cutting-edge technology to disrupt traditional industries. However, these disruptors are wider than small and agile organizations. Even large corporations and governments use technology to innovate and stay competitive in the digital age.
